Multan Sultans lockhorns against Quetta Gladiators in match 28 of Pakistan Super League (PSL) on Sunday, 18th May, 2025. The match is slated to be played at Rawalpindi Cricket Stadium, Rawalpindi and the scheduled start time is 15:30 PM IST.Β 

Current Standings – Multan Sultan stand at the bottom of the points table with 2 points in 9 matches ( 1 win & 8 losses) and on the other hand Quetta Gladiators stand at the top of the points table with 13 points in 9 matches (6 wins, 2 losses & 1 no result).

Head to Head Record –  Multan Sultans and Quetta Gladiators squared off in 14 matches in the PSL and Quetta Gladiators won 5 matches, while Multan Sultans hold a dominant record with 9 wins. In their last meeting, Quetta Gladiators defeated Multan Sultans by 10 wickets earlier in the season.Β 

Multan Sultans Preview

It’s a tough situation for the Multan Sultans as they’ve been knocked out of the tournament, having suffered 8 defeats. In their last match against Peshawar Zalmi is now a dead rubber. In that encounter, the Sultans were bundled out for a meager 108 runs in 19.1 overs. Shai Hope top-scored with 23 runs, followed by Tayyab Tahir with 22, and Mohammad Rizwan, who got a start with 17 runs but couldn’t convert it into a substantial innings.

The Sultans’ batting has been their Achilles’ heel this season. Despite boasting quality international players, they’ve struggled to capitalize and post competitive totals. Mohammad Rizwan has been a lone warrior with the bat, accumulating 363 runs in 9 matches at an impressive average of 61.

On the bowling front, Ubaid Shah leads the wicket-taking charts with 11 scalps. However, the rest of the bowling attack has lacked the consistency and penetration needed throughout the season. In this final game, the Sultans will be playing for pride, aiming to finish their campaign on a winning note.

Quetta Gladiators Preview

The Quetta Gladiators have had a remarkable campaign thus far, establishing themselves as a formidable force with 6 wins. They will be aiming to conclude the league stage at the top of the table, as the Kings are breathing down their necks, also sitting on 12 points. A victory in their upcoming match would secure the top spot for the Gladiators.

In their previous encounter, the Gladiators locked horns with Islamabad United and, batting first, posted a mammoth total of 263/3. Rilee Rossouw smashed a blistering 104 runs off just 46 deliveries, while Hasan Nawaz remained unbeaten on a magnificent 100 runs from 45 balls. Subsequently, the Gladiators’ bowlers dismantled Islamabad United for a mere 154 runs in 19.3 overs. Mohammad Amir spearheaded the bowling attack, bagging an impressive 3 wickets for just 6 runs.

Hasan Nawaz is currently the leading run-scorer for the Quetta Gladiators with 250 runs. With the ball, the enigmatic Abrar Ahmed has been their trump card, picking up 14 wickets and leading the wicket-taking chart for the Gladiators.Β 

Rilee Rossouw has also been in scintillating form, accumulating 234 runs this season. The bowling unit has been a cohesive force, with Faheem Ashraf (13 wickets), Mohammad Amir (10 wickets), and Khurram Shahzad (11 wickets) all contributing significantly, making it a challenging prospect for opposition teams this season.

MS vs QTG Pitch Report

The pitch at Rawalpindi Cricket Stadium heavily favors the batters, making it a high-scoring venue. The average first innings score across the 8 matches played this season is a substantial 219 runs. Notably, scores exceeding 200 have been achieved 8 times when batting first this season. In stark contrast, only once a team has scored over 160 runs while chasing this season.Β 

Toss: To Bat

Teams batting first have dominated at the Rawalpindi Cricket Stadium this season, winning 7 out of the 8 matches played. Chasing has proven challenging at this venue, as the pitch tends to slow down slightly, making it difficult for batters to time their shots effectively.
